Программная реализация задачи расчета коэффициента ритмичности продукции - Курсовая работа

бесплатно 0
4.5 138
Создание программы, автоматизирующей расчет коэффициента ритмичности продукции с использованием электронных таблиц средствами языка программирования Си. Консолидация данных в MSExcel. Программная реализация алгоритма. Тестирование разработанного ПО.


Аннотация к работе
2.2 Решение задачи в среде ExcelДанная курсовая работа направлена на разработку программного продукта, реализующего вычисление коэффициента ритмичности. Задачи курсовой работы можно сформулировать так: - создать программу, автоматизирующую расчет коэффициента ритмичности; В курсовой работе реализованы возможности программы Excel и языка программирования С , поскольку при помощи этих программных средств и решаются поставленный задачи.В данной курсовой работе необходимо было разработать программу позволяющую вычислять коэффициент ритмичности за один месяц для каждого вида продукции, создавать таблицы с данными и использовать эти данные в дальнейших вычислениях. Чтобы вычислить коэффициент ритмичности можно воспользоваться формулой, представленной на Рисунке 1: Рисунок 1 - Формула вычисления коэффициента ритмичности Коэффициент ритмичности рассчитывается как сумма продукции, зачтенной в выполнение плана по ритмичности на плановый выпуск продукции. В выполнение плана по ритмичности засчитывается фактический выпуск продукции, но не больше запланированного. Равномерный выпуск продукции данным основным цехом обеспечивает устойчивость работы следующих за ним по технической цепочке подразделений и предприятия в целом по выполнению своих договорных обязательств.Дополнительные удобства для моделирования дает возможность графического представления данных (диаграммы), а также возможность использования электронной таблицы в качестве базы данных, хотя по сравнению с системами управления базами данных (СУБД) электронные таблицы имеют меньшие возможности в этой области. По данной формуле рассчитывается разница для продукта №1, для остальной продукции в формуле меняется только номер строки. Наименование продукции Всего по плану за 4 недели Всего факт. за 4 недели Разница между факт. и по плану продукт №1 400 460 60 продукт №2 800 910 110 продукт №3 1500 1545 45 продукт №4 1600 1729 129 продукт №5 2000 1885-115 продукт №6 2400 2530 130 продукт №7 2800 2895 95 продукт №8 3600 3244-356 продукт №9 3600 3660 60 продукт №10 4000 4275 275 продукт №11 4400 4375-25 продукт №12 4950 4500-450 Наименование продукции Всего по плану за 4 недели Всего факт. за 4 недели Разница между факт. и по плану продукт №1 420 440 20 продукт №2 820 710-110 продукт №3 1225 1045-180 продукт №4 1620 1240-380 продукт №5 2320 2240-80 продукт №6 2820 2630-190 продукт №7 2950 3040 90 продукт №8 3300 3220-80 продукт №9 3620 3470-150 продукт №10 4200 4310 110 продукт №11 4320 4240-80 продукт №12 4820 4520-300 Наименование продукции Всего по плану за 4 недели Всего факт. за 4 недели Разница между факт. и по плану продукт №1 460 495 35 продукт №2 910 945 35 продукт №3 1260 1300 40 продукт №4 1600 1635 35 продукт №5 2210 2180-30 продукт №6 2460 2530 70 продукт №7 2860 2895 35 продукт №8 3209 3244 35 продукт №9 3625 3445-180 продукт №10 4060 4275 215 продукт №11 4350 4375 25 продукт №12 4910 4985 75Язык Си представляет собой удачный компромисс между желанием располагать теми возможностями, которые обычно предоставляют программисту столь понятные и удобные языки высокого уровня, и стремлением эффективно использовать особенности компьютера. Кроме набора средств, присущих современным языкам программирования высокого уровня (структурность, модульность, определяемые типы данных) в него включены средства для программирования «почти» на уровне ассемблера (использование указателей, побитовые операции, операции сдвига). Благодаря близости по скорости выполнения программ, написанных на СИ, к языку ассемблера, этот язык получил широкое применение при создании системного программного обеспечения и прикладного обеспечения для решения широкого круга задач. Программа, написанная на языке Си всегда начинает выполняться с функции, называемой main(). Главой функцией любой программы на С является INTMAIN(), с которой и начинается начало запуска самой программы.Ввиду высокой эффективности языком реализации программного продукта был выбран высокоуровневый язык Си, визуальная среда программирования C Builder.

План
СОДЕРЖАНИЕ

ВВЕДЕНИЕ

1. ОБЩАЯ ПОСТАНОВКА ЗАДАЧИ

2. РЕШЕНИЕ ЗАДАЧИ СРЕДСТВАМИ ПАКЕТОВ ПРИКЛАДНЫХ ПРОГРАММ

Вывод
Целью данного курсовой работы являлась разработка и реализация алгоритма на языке программирования С задачи на тему: «Программная реализация задачи расчета коэффициента ритмичности продукции»

Ввиду высокой эффективности языком реализации программного продукта был выбран высокоуровневый язык Си, визуальная среда программирования C Builder.

В курсовой работе были достигнуты некоторые цели: - поставленная задача была решена с помощью программного продукта MSEXCEL и языка программирования С , в ходе чего получился программный продукт для реализации необходимых вычислений

- рассмотрен теоретический аспект, необходимый для выполнения поставленной задачи;

- проведен анализ полученных результатов;

- автоматизировано вычисление коэффициента ритмичности

Список литературы
1. Ворожков А.В. Алгоритмы: построение, анализ и реализация на языке программирования Си. / Ворожков А.В., Винокуров Н.А.; -М., 2007.-452с.

2. Джелен Билл Сводные таблицы в Microsoft Excel. / Джелен Билл, Александер Майкл.; - Пер. с англ. - М.: ООО "И.Д. Вильямс", 2007. -320 с.

3. Елизаров, Ю.Ф. Экономика организаций (предприятий): учебник / Ю.Ф. Елизаров. - Москва: Экзамен, 2008. - 495 с.

4. Кондратьева, М.Н. Экономика предприятия: учебное пособие / М.Н. Кондратьева, Е.В. Баландина. - Ульяновск: УЛГТУ, 2011. - 174 с.

5. Могилев А.В. Информатика: Учеб. Пособие для студ. Пед. Вузов / А.В. Могилев, Н.И. Пак, Е.К. Хеннер; под ред. Е.К. Хеннера. 3-е изд., перераб. И доп. - М.: Издательский центр «Академия»б 2004. - 848с

6. Павловская Т.А. C/C . Программирование на языке высокого уровня. - СПБ.: Питер, 2001-2010. - 461 с.

7. Подбельский В.В. Программирование на языке Си: Учеб. Пособие. / Подбельский В.В., Фомин С.С.; - М.: Финансы и статистика, 2005.-600с.

8. Рудикова Л.В. Microsoft Excel для студента. - СПБ.: БХВ-Петербург, 2005. -368 с.
Заказать написание новой работы



Дисциплины научных работ



Хотите, перезвоним вам?